The answer is <em>A; manufacture</em>. The word can be used as a verb when it means making something on a large scale. This is an action word, or a verb.
Ex: A company that <em>manufactures</em>paint.
When used as a verb, "manufacture" usually has an "s" or "ed" added on to the end of it (as seen above), except in certain cases (below).
Ex: To <em>manufacture</em>goods on such a large scale by hand must be so much work!
